Research interest
Research focused on Temozolomide and Glioma, with related work in PKM2, Histone, Gene knockdown. Notable publications include 'Polymer-locking fusogenic liposomes for glioblastoma-targeted siRNA delivery and CRISPR–Cas gene editing', 'Histone lactylation-derived LINC01127 promotes the self-renewal of glioblastoma stem cells via the cis-regulating the MAP4K4 to activate JNK pathway', and 'LncRNA‐Mediated TPI1 and PKM2 Promote Self‐Renewal and Chemoresistance in GBM'.
